Burundi Ambassador Calls for Enhanced Cooperation and Investment from China

By KhabarAsia.com Staff Reporter

The East African nation of Burundi is strengthening its ties with China, seeking to leverage China’s development experience to boost its own economic growth. Burundian Ambassador to China, Telesphore Irambona, highlighted the burgeoning cooperation between the two countries in sectors such as agriculture, infrastructure, and energy.

During President Évariste Ndayishimiye’s two visits to China in the past year, a key objective was to gain insights from China’s rapid development. “We are eager to learn from China’s experience,” Ambassador Irambona stated. “China’s journey from a developing country to one of the world’s leading economies is a source of inspiration for us.”

One significant development is China’s zero-tariff treatment for Burundian products, which is expected to significantly enhance the nation’s agricultural production. “This initiative opens new markets for our farmers and boosts our agricultural sector,” said Irambona. “It will help increase income for our rural population and contribute to food security.”

Ambassador Irambona also emphasized Burundi’s attractiveness as a destination for Chinese investors. “With our strategic location in Central Africa, abundant natural resources, and a rich labor force, Burundi offers numerous opportunities,” he noted. “We welcome Chinese businesses to invest in various sectors, including mining, agriculture, and infrastructure development.”

Highlighting the importance of leadership in national development, Irambona praised China’s remarkable achievements. “China’s success is deeply rooted in its excellent leadership,” he said. “We believe that strong leadership is essential for driving progress and fostering international partnerships.”

The ambassador called for increased Chinese investment, expressing confidence that enhanced cooperation would be mutually beneficial. “Our partnership with China is based on mutual respect and shared goals,” he concluded. “Together, we can achieve significant advancements for both our nations.”
